My Battery wasn't charging on my laptop, so i followed these steps:

 

Device Manage -> Batteries - Uninstalled Microsoft ACPI-Complient Control Method Battery -> Removed my battery from my laptop - waited about a minute -> put it back in and scanned for hardware changes

 

now its telling me that its charging again.. the charge (24%) is not going down, but its not going up either, I'm not sure what I can do from here to make it charge instead of stay at 24%
